Insufficient Air Conditioning Performance
When a cooling system fails to cool down a room sufficiently, it can cause discomfort and frustration for the owners. Inadequate cooling efficiency can stem from numerous problems, including an unclean air filter, which limits airflow, or low refrigerant degrees due to leaks. Furthermore, malfunctioning elements such as the compressor or evaporator can impede reliable cooling. Thermostat settings may likewise be incorrectly set up, creating the unit to underperform. Normal upkeep is necessary to stop these troubles, ensuring the air conditioning system operates effectively. Identifying the source immediately can help with prompt repairs and restore suitable air conditioning, boosting interior comfort and expanding the life expectancy of the system.

Regular Cycling Issues
Frequent cycling concerns in cooling systems can significantly influence convenience and power efficiency. This sensation occurs when the device activates and off quickly, stopping working to maintain a regular temperature level. Typical signs and symptoms include fluctuating indoor temperature levels and boosted power bills. The sources of constant cycling might include a malfunctioning thermostat, wrong refrigerant degrees, or filthy air filters that restrict air flow. In some cases, an extra-large cooling device can likewise bring about rapid biking, as it cools the space too rapidly without sufficient runtime. Determining these problems without delay is necessary, as prolonged biking can cause raised endure the system, minimized lifespan, and greater repair costs. Routine maintenance can mitigate these troubles and boost total performance.
Repairing Your A/c Device: Step-by-Step Guide
Lots of property owners run into issues with their air conditioning systems at some time, resulting in pain throughout hot weather. To fix effectively, one ought to initially inspect the thermostat settings, ensuring it is set to "cool" and the wanted temperature level is reduced than the current area temperature level. Next, checking the air filters for dirt and clogs is essential, as clogged up filters can impede airflow.
Checking out the power supply and circuit breakers for any kind of stumbled buttons is necessary if the unit stops working to start. Paying attention for unusual sounds can also give hints; rattling or grinding might show mechanical issues or loosened components.
Assessing the outside condenser system for particles or obstructions is essential, as this can affect effectiveness. By adhering to these steps, home owners can identify common issues prior to looking for specialist help, making sure an extra comfortable living environment throughout the summertime months.
Do It Yourself Fixes for Minor A/c Issues
A variety of minor HVAC issues can frequently be dealt with through simple DIY repairs, conserving both time and cash for homeowners. One typical concern is a blocked air filter, which can restrict air movement and decrease performance. Property owners can easily cleanse the filter or replace to boost system efficiency. In addition, checking and tightening loose electrical connections can avoid undesirable power disturbances and enhance safety and security.
One more simple task is cleansing the condenser coils, which can accumulate dirt and particles, impeding warm exchange. By switching off the system and delicately cleaning the coils, property owners can keep perfect performance.
Making certain that the thermostat is correctly calibrated can get rid of imprecise temperature level readings. A basic recalibration can result in enhanced comfort and power cost savings. While these minor repair work are convenient, it is vital for home owners to acknowledge their limitations and focus on safety throughout the process.

Thermostat Calibration Checks
Frequently neglected, thermostat calibration checks are vital for keeping a successfully running air conditioning system. A poorly adjusted thermostat can bring about inaccurate temperature analyses, creating the device to cycle needlessly or fall short to get to the desired comfort degree. To execute a calibration check, one need to contrast the thermostat's analysis with a trustworthy thermostat put near the unit. If disparities are discovered, modifications might be needed to guarantee precision. Regular calibration checks, ideally performed throughout seasonal evaluations, can stop excessive power consumption and promote a longer life-span for the air conditioner system. By prioritizing this easy yet crucial maintenance action, homeowners can improve convenience and performance, ultimately decreasing repair service expenses and improving overall system efficiency.
